My Name is
Nancy
![](/Files/Child Images/2023Q1/CD0922023Q1Profile.png)
Nancy
Nancy’s mother died, and her father is unknown. Before arriving at Rafiki, Nancy lived with her elderly grandmother. Though she tried, her grandmother could not properly care for her. Nancy arrived at the Rafiki Village Kenya in 2009. Nancy shows interest in physical education classes, especially volleyball and soccer. She also enjoys language arts, literature, and reading. She is above-average academically. She conducts herself with respect, enthusiasm, care, and responsibility. Through the Rafiki Bible Study, she has learned that we should live a life that is pleasing to God by obeying what He tells us in His Word.
